FRISCO — Dallas Cowboys fans have begged and pleaded in recent years for their team to make the gamble and go after a big name by trade or through free agency. A year ago, they infamously allowed Derrick Henry to sign with the Baltimore Ravens despite a perfectly clear avenue to pursue him.
This offseason, they made the necessary moves through free agency and the draft. However, they had not pursued any needle-moving players through those major acquisition periods.
That all changed in May when the Cowboys traded for George Pickens, providing a major upgrade at the wide receiver position. This gives Dallas one of the most formidable duos on paper heading into next season.
But the Cowboys are not the only ones aware of the enormity of this deal. Their aggressive maneuvering has their most staunch adversaries on notice.
“The spotlight is on him because I’ve talked with a lot of people around the league, including the NFC East. That Pickens trade has their full attention,” ESPN's Fowler said Saturday.
“They believe that really does add a new dimension because he’s one of the best contested ball-catchers in the entire league. If he can stay on the upright, keep that maturity sort of in check in a contract year, he’ll do big things with CeeDee Lamb and Dak Prescott.”
The duality of Pickens' and Lamb's talents should blend together with brilliance. Lamb's precision as a route runner out of the slot combining with Pickens' downfield presence makes for a tantalizing air-raid punch.
But if foes around the NFC East are taking notice, it's because they have done the same things to establish themselves as contenders. The Washington Commanders made trades for Laremy Tunsil and Deebo Samuel at the star of the offseason while the Philadelphia Eagles have stretched their big moves over the last several years.
A trade for A.J. Brown a few years back and the signing of Saquon Barkley a year ago made them undeniable in their quest for a title.
Time will tell if a similar fate awaits the Cowboys. Regardless, the trade for Pickens is reflective of that contending mindset and one that could pay off in a major way.
